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_032124.5(HDHD2):​c.601A>T​(p.Met201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HDHD2 (HGNC:25364): (haloacid dehalogenase like hydrolase domain containing 2) Enables enzyme binding activity. Predicted to be involved in dephosphorylation. Located in extracellular exosome.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sNov 24, 2024The c.601A>T (p.M201L) alteration is located in exon 5 (coding exon 4) of the HDHD2 gene. This alteration results from a A to T substitution at nucleotide position 601, causing the methionine (M) at amino acid position 201 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
